We're working with an established software business embarking on a significant AI transformation, offering a unique opportunity to shape the future of their technology landscape.

The Role

  • Join a pioneering team at the outset of a major AI transformation.
  • Contribute directly to the decision-making process for new AI solutions.
  • Work on building foundational AI systems, not just prototypes.
  • Be instrumental in integrating cutting-edge AI into existing software.
